Struct panda_sys::ChardevRingbuf
source · #[repr(C)]pub struct ChardevRingbuf {
pub has_logfile: bool,
pub logfile: *mut c_char,
pub has_logappend: bool,
pub logappend: bool,
pub has_size: bool,
pub size: i64,
}
Fields§
§has_logfile: bool
§logfile: *mut c_char
§has_logappend: bool
§logappend: bool
§has_size: bool
§size: i64
Trait Implementations§
source§impl Clone for ChardevRingbuf
impl Clone for ChardevRingbuf
source§fn clone(&self) -> ChardevRingbuf
fn clone(&self) -> ChardevRingbuf
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for ChardevRingbuf
impl Debug for ChardevRingbuf
impl Copy for ChardevRingbuf
Auto Trait Implementations§
impl RefUnwindSafe for ChardevRingbuf
impl !Send for ChardevRingbuf
impl !Sync for ChardevRingbuf
impl Unpin for ChardevRingbuf
impl UnwindSafe for ChardevRingbuf
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more